What is a tile saw?

Just as the name suggests, a tile saw is a special tool used to cut tiles into size. In most cases, this saw is often confused for a miter saw thanks to their striking similarities.

The main difference, however, is that tile saws use diamond-coated blades or steel blades coupled with a water cooling system to cut tiles of different materials. They can cut ceramic, porcelain, natural stone and glass tiles.

Furthermore, they can also be used to cut other materials such as wood, metal, granite and marble, depending on the type of blade. Unlike other types of saw blades that have teeth (such as reciprocating saws), tile saws blades are relatively smooth. They grind through the tile rather than rip or tear the workpiece.

Tile saw parts

Tile saws consist of several vital parts. The most important parts include:

  • Adjustable rip guide – A rip guide or fence allows you to make precise cuts along the line of cut. It is an essential part of any cutting, as it determines the overall accuracy of the saw.
  • Tile saw motor blade – The blade performs all the cutting tasks. Tile saw blades come in various shapes and sizes. They are also made from a wide range of materials. Common motor blades include, tile saw diamond blade, tile saw steel blade, tile saw glass blade and tile saw blade for porcelain, among many other types.
  • Tile saw water pump – Cutting jobs can be very demanding, leading to overheating of the tile blade. To prevent heating, water is often used. A tile saw water pump drives water from the pan to the blade to prevent overheating.
  • Tile saw water reservoir – Usually found in wet tile saws, a water reservoir stores water to be used when cutting various types of materials. The water prevents overheating while cutting rocks with a saw at the same time minimizes on dust.
  • Dust port – The right tile saw should come with a dust collection mechanism to prevent the accumulation of sawdust.
  • Tile saw blade wrench/key – You may be required to replace or change your tile saw blade from time to time depending on the condition of the blade and the type of project you are working on. A tile saw blade wrench or key comes in handy when you want to make quick replacements.

How to use a tile saw

Whether you are a devoted do-it-yourselfer or a professional artisan, learning how to use a tile saw is essential if you are to tackle tiling projects effectively. This will also ensure that you achieve smooth, precise cuts without damaging the material or the machine. Below are steps on how to use a tile saw.

10 Marvelous Tile Saw – For the Professional Handyman in 2022

  1. Set up the tile saw securely on a sturdy surface to avoid inaccurate cuts and prevent injury. Most people prefer tabletop tile saws as they come already secured.
  2. When using a wet tile saw, fill the reservoir with clean water, making sure that the pump is submerged completely.
  3. Position the tile on the workbench or cutting table while adjusting the fence accordingly. The blade should line up with the line of cut for enhanced accuracy.
  4. Plug the saw into the power outlet and turn it on. Make sure that enough water is flowing to the blade before you start cutting the tile. The reason for spraying the blade is to avoid overheating and damage to the tile.
  5. Feed the tile gently into the blade, ensuring that you guide it along the line of cut
  6. Pull the cut pieces away and turn off the saw.
  7. Clean up the saw and your work area after completing your project.

Bridge tile saw vs. Sliding table saw

10 Marvelous Tile Saw – For the Professional Handyman in 2022Bridge tile saws are often preferred for home improvement projects that involve cutting large tile saws. This is because they are incredibly versatile and can deliver smooth, accurate cuts on larger formats. However, this saw is not ideal for cutting angle cuts and notches

Sliding table saws, on the other hand, are super accurate and do not cost as much as bridge tile saws. They can rip through various types of materials, but are mostly used for light tiling projects that require more precision.

Unlike bridge saws, sliding table saws can cut notches, cross cuts and angle cuts.

Wet tile saw vs. Dry tile saw

10 Marvelous Tile Saw – For the Professional Handyman in 2022The main difference between a wet tile saw and a dry tile saw is that the former (wet saws) come with a blade attached to a water reservoir while dry saws do not require water to cut.

Wet tile saws are ideal for cutting tough materials considering the fact that the blade does not overheat during operation as it is the case with dry saws.

They also tend to be more durable as the existence of water minimizes friction, subsequently extending machine life.

 

Handheld tile saw vs. Table tile saw

10 Marvelous Tile Saw – For the Professional Handyman in 2022Also known as masonry saws, handheld tile saws are operated by hand. They are perfect for small and medium tiling projects that require angled or odd shaped cuts. They can also be used to remove old tiles from a site that requires renovations.

The main advantage of handheld saws is that they are often lightweight, making them highly portable. Furthermore, no set up is required to use handheld saws.

As the name implies, table tile saws are mounted on top of a table. They are used to tackle heavy-duty projects that require a large work area. These saws work efficiently just like handheld saws, but they tend to be bulkier and less portable.
